Output bbb05f3c954eebba0e32b21f2ae486ae1e3454b829bf5944f247237769213988:0

value
50690000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0437c5086cc3830785eb1977c1755237d3c120fa OP_EQUAL
address
325KSFjyYiCuouHKdBcBekMfNDCPDeRHm3
transaction
bbb05f3c954eebba0e32b21f2ae486ae1e3454b829bf5944f247237769213988
confirmations
262227
spent
true